Local-first book production

Keep the project, images, exports and backups where you can control them.

Many writing and publishing tools assume a hosted account. InkVault is designed around local project folders: manuscript content, book metadata, images, layout settings, backups and generated exports stay understandable as files.

  • Offline-first writing, chapter editing and book formatting.
  • Local folders for manuscripts, assets, backups and exports.
  • PDF, HTML, DOCX and EPUB-oriented export workflows.
  • Self-hosted option for customers who want browser access on their own compatible server.

FAQ

Offline publishing software questions

Does InkVault work offline?

InkVault is designed as offline-first publishing software. Normal writing, chapter organization, layout work, exports and backups are meant to happen locally.

Where are manuscript projects stored?

InkVault projects are built around local folders for manuscripts, images, metadata, exports and backups, so the project remains understandable outside a hosted account.

Is a cloud subscription required?

No. The local edition is positioned as downloadable software without a mandatory SaaS workspace or third-party manuscript cloud.
